Delayed Flashes from Counter Jets of Gamma Ray Bursts
Abstract
If X-ray flashes are due to the forward jet emissions from gamma ray bursts (GRBs) observed with large viewing angles, we show that a prompt emission from a counter jet should be observed as a delayed flash in the UV or optical band several hours to a day after the X-ray flash. Ultraviolet and Optical Telescope on Swift can observe the delayed flashes within ~13 Mpc, so that (double-sided) jets of GRBs may be directly confirmed. Since the event rate of delayed flashes detected by Swift may be as small as 6*10^{-5}events/yr, we require more sensitive detectors in future experiments.
